Welcome to the Mackey Cemetery's Wreaths Across America Page. 

On December 14, 2025 at 3:00 pm (Wreath Placement Immediately following the ceremony), Wreaths Across America will be at Mackey Cemetery to Remember and Honor our veterans through the laying of Remembrance wreaths on the graves of our country's fallen heroes and the act of saying the name of each and every veteran aloud.

Ceremony and Volunteer Information

We are happy that you are willing to help with our Wreath Across America ceremony at Mackey Cemetery. Please do not forget to register to volunteer! That way you will get all updates about the cemetery itself.

Here are some things to remember about the ceremony:

  • Ceremony will be held at the Mackey Church, 288 V Avenue, Mackey, IA
  • Everyone of all ages and backgrounds is welcome.
  • Please help ensure that all participants get the opportunity to place a wreath.
  • Please follow the location coordinators instructions on where to place wreaths, as well as "how" they should be placed.
  • We especially appreciate volunteers willing to help clean-up. Please check in with the location coordinator if you are interested in helping with the clean-up.

The most important thing to remember is to have a wonderful experience participating in the ceremony and thank you so much for help Wreaths achieve our mission to remember, honor and teach.
